Step 3: Register your plugin with StatusQuail

StatusQuail is the deploy-status chat bot for the Pellwright platform. Declare your plugin's commands in the manifest. Keep handlers under 2s; slow plugins get throttled. Test against the sandbox bot first — production registration is gated. All plugin releases must be signed before the registry accepts them, so sign with the key provided directly below.

deploy key for kajof-fajop: bky6_gDHw9Q

Alert: Fernwick template rendering p95 has exceeded 800ms for ten consecutive minutes. This usually indicates fragment cache eviction pressure rather than a code regression, so new responders should check cache hit rates before rolling back. If hit rates look normal, inspect recent theme deploys. The full triage checklist for this alert is maintained here.

operations page: https://jenkins.zemvarcloud.local/job/merge_requests/repo/build/73930b4b30f0a8ed

### Step 4: Cold Start Tuning

The Quillback handlers cold-start slowly after the migration to the Fenwick runtime. Pre-warm is mandatory for the checkout and ledger functions. Do not touch concurrency caps without sign-off from the platform lead. Set provisioned warm pools before the first deploy. Apply exactly the following configuration values to the handler service:

service settings:
[briius]
port = 3000
region = outer-1
host = briius.zarqeldyn.internal
team = wenael
timeout_ms = 2000
retries = 5